Will my reflash work with comptech sc ?
I searched but did not get an exact answer. I have a 06 and recently got the the hondata reflash and was thinking of maybe getting the comptech supercharger. will my reflash work with the SC or will I have to use the reflash that comptech offers?

It will not . U need to get a new reflash for use with SC. Every program in ecu is confugured to a special set of equipment, your program isnt compatible with SC. For best results u need SC , icebox, header, and while sending ecu for new reflash u need to mention all this changes to reflasher.

Someone here (MMsTSX ?) bought an SC but got a wrong reflash by mistake. They gave him the reflash for bolt-ons instead of SC. The car gained power and didn't break in like a year of driving. It did not blow up or anything but only when it was dyno's and VTEC engagement point at 5000 rpms was revealed was it clear that there was wrong programming of the ECU. I think it gained like 10 HP after correct reflash was done.
So in conclusion, your reflash CAN work with SC, its just that u do not want it to.... Oh and if u are reflashed, there is a $100 discount for SC. I would rather exchange your ECU for a non--reflashed ECU + $300? $500? Then I would program that "new" ECU to work with SC

^^ If you buy the kit new, the SC comes with the reflash. I wouldn't run the NA reflash with the SC setup. If you're buying the kit used, your options are K-Pro or contacting Hondata to see if they will do the SC reflash for you. I would lean towards K-Pro if you can afford it, you'll be able to expand on the system later if you want then.
